Western Australia recorded 3 new cases of COVID-19 over the weekend.
A recap of Perth COVID-19 activity over the weekend has seen 3 new cases of COVID-19 recorded and now 18 active cases being monitored in Western Australia.
On Saturday there was 1 new case recorded – a 30-year-old woman returning from overseas.
Sunday there were a further 2 new cases recorded – males in their 50s and 60s returning to Perth from overseas.

All 3 cases are in hotel quarantine.
Western Australia’s COVID-19 total now stands at 799. Department of Health is now monitoring 18 active cases.
772 people have recovered from the virus.
